Why Developers Prefer Jenkins: 5 Key Reasons

Open-Source CI Tool: Jenkins is a Java-based open-source tool for continuous integration (CI).

Master-Slave Model: It uses a master-slave setup to distribute tasks and accumulate results.

Active Community: Jenkins has a vibrant community that contributes plugins and improves code.

Installation Flexibility: Install via packages, Docker, or standalone mode with Java Runtime Environment.

Automation Boost: Jenkins automates software tasks, advancing development processes.

User-Friendly: It offers an intuitive interface for easy use.

Rich Plugin Library: 1000+ plugins support integration, testing, and more.

Web-Based Setup: Simple job configuration via web GUI.

CI Foundation: Jenkins supports early defect detection through Continuous Integration.

 Strong Community: Its large community and plugins enhance project collaboration and maintenance.
